首页
学习
活动
专区
工具
TVP
发布
精选内容/技术社群/优惠产品,尽在小程序
立即前往

获取百分比计算并更新列

是指通过对列中的数值进行计算,得到相应的百分比,并将计算结果更新到另一列或同一列中。

在前端开发中,可以通过JavaScript来实现获取百分比计算并更新列的功能。可以使用以下步骤来实现:

  1. 遍历每一行数据,获取需要计算百分比的数值以及相关的参考数值。
  2. 使用适当的算法来计算百分比,例如:(数值 / 参考数值) * 100。
  3. 将计算得到的百分比结果更新到指定的列中,可以使用DOM操作来修改对应的元素。

以下是一个简单的示例,演示如何使用JavaScript在HTML表格中获取百分比并更新列:

代码语言:txt
复制
<!DOCTYPE html>
<html>
<head>
  <title>获取百分比计算并更新列</title>
</head>
<body>
  <table id="data-table">
    <tr>
      <th>数值</th>
      <th>参考数值</th>
      <th>百分比</th>
    </tr>
    <tr>
      <td>50</td>
      <td>100</td>
      <td></td>
    </tr>
    <tr>
      <td>75</td>
      <td>200</td>
      <td></td>
    </tr>
    <tr>
      <td>120</td>
      <td>150</td>
      <td></td>
    </tr>
  </table>

  <script>
    // 获取数据表格
    var table = document.getElementById("data-table");
    
    // 获取所有行(排除表头)
    var rows = table.getElementsByTagName("tr");
    for (var i = 1; i < rows.length; i++) {
      var cells = rows[i].getElementsByTagName("td");
      
      // 获取数值和参考数值
      var value = parseInt(cells[0].innerHTML);
      var reference = parseInt(cells[1].innerHTML);
      
      // 计算百分比
      var percentage = (value / reference) * 100;
      
      // 更新百分比列
      cells[2].innerHTML = percentage.toFixed(2) + "%";
    }
  </script>
</body>
</html>

在这个示例中,我们通过JavaScript获取了表格数据,并遍历每一行进行百分比计算。最后,将计算结果更新到百分比列中。

以上只是一个简单示例,实际应用中可能会涉及更复杂的数据和逻辑。根据具体的需求,可以使用不同的前端框架和库来实现获取百分比计算并更新列的功能。

在腾讯云中,提供了一系列云计算产品,例如云服务器、云数据库、云存储等。具体根据实际需求选择适合的产品,并参考腾讯云官方文档获取详细的产品介绍和使用方法。

希望以上内容能够帮助您理解获取百分比计算并更新列的概念以及实现方式。如有其他问题,请随时提问。

页面内容是否对你有帮助?
有帮助
没帮助

相关·内容

自动获取更新HTTPS证书并实现Nginx代理WSS协议

自动获取/更新HTTPS证书以及实现Nginx代理WSS协议 如果说我比别人看得更远些,那是因为我站在了巨人的肩上-----牛顿 有了轮子就会事半功倍,此篇文章就是站在巨人的肩膀上做一个简单的总结。...一个快速获取/更新 Let's encrypt 证书的 shell script GitHub 完整说明文档 想折腾!!!...自己动手生成证书可以参考这个篇博客 以下为文档详细内容以及我测试环境的配置,贴过来是为了方便离线阅读 ---- 脚本中是调用 acme_tiny.py 认证、获取、更新证书,不需要额外的依赖。...path/to/cert/example.chained.crt; ssl_certificate_key /path/to/cert/example.com.key; cron 定时任务 每个月自动更新一次证书

1K20
  • 【C#】让DataGridView输入中实时更新数据源中的计算列

    非得是焦点离开这一行(去到别的行,或者其它控件),计算列才会更新。——这段话信息量略大,不熟悉dgv提交机制的猿友可能得借助下面进一步的说明才能明白~老鸟请绕道。...dt和dv的编辑/提交等操作是以【行】为单元 下面是dgv的常规提交流程: ①编辑dgv单元格→②完成编辑(离开焦点)→③提交数据源(源行仍处于编辑状态)→④焦点离开dgv行→⑤源行结束编辑状态→⑥源行更新计算列...可以看到,计算列得到更新的关键有两处: dgv单元格的数据要提交到数据源相应单元格 源行结束编辑状态 按常规提交流程,必须使焦点离开单元格所在的行(只离开单元格都不行哦)才能达到目的,而我们的需求是,编辑的过程中就要实时更新...一、解决实时更新计算列的问题 可以通过dgv的CurrentCellDirtyStateChanged事件达到目的: private void dgv_CurrentCellDirtyStateChanged...只有这样,源行的计算列才会更新 (dgv.CurrentRow.DataBoundItem as DataRowView).EndEdit(); //或者执行

    5.3K20

    .NET从互联网上获取当前时间并更新系统时间

    于是写了个程序从百度服务器上获取时间,每次开机更新一下就OK了。  这里是控制台程序,放在启动文件夹下面开机就会自动运行了。当然如果你受不了每次开机都弹控制台的黑窗口也可以封成window服务。...更新系统时间使用VB.NET的API方便快捷! 时间从百度服务器上获取,当然这种方法获取的时间有误差,只精确到分,如果网速不给力的话也会影响误差。 对我来收这个误差可以接受了!...string[] args)  9         { 10             try 11             { 12                 Console.WriteLine("更新时间开始...                 Microsoft.VisualBasic.DateAndTime.TimeOfDay = dt; 16                 Console.WriteLine("更新完成

    58520

    按照A列进行分组并计算出B列每个分组的平均值,然后对B列内的每个元素减去分组平均值

    一、前言 前几天在Python星耀交流群有个叫【在下不才】的粉丝问了一个Pandas的问题,按照A列进行分组并计算出B列每个分组的平均值,然后对B列内的每个元素减去分组平均值,这里拿出来给大家分享下,一起学习...888] df = pd.DataFrame({'lv': lv, 'num': num}) def demean(arr): return arr - arr.mean() # 按照"lv"列进行分组并计算出..."num"列每个分组的平均值,然后"num"列内的每个元素减去分组平均值 df["juncha"] = df.groupby("lv")["num"].transform(demean) print(df...输出也是一列),代码如下: import pandas as pd lv = [1, 2, 2, 3, 3, 4, 2, 3, 3, 3, 3] num = [122, 111, 222, 444,...这篇文章主要分享了Pandas处理相关知识,基于粉丝提出的按照A列进行分组并计算出B列每个分组的平均值,然后对B列内的每个元素减去分组平均值的问题,给出了3个行之有效的方法,帮助粉丝顺利解决了问题。

    3K20

    论对 TOP 命令的入门总结

    负值表示高优先级,正值表示低优先级 j P 最后使用的CPU,仅在多CPU环境下有意义 k %CPU 上次更新到现在的CPU时间占用百分比 l TIME 进程使用的CPU时间总计,单位秒 m TIME+...top 命令选项 top [-] [d] [p] [q] [C] [S] [s] [n] -d 后跟秒数,指定每两次屏幕信息刷新之间的时间间隔,表示进程界面更新时间(默认为5秒)。...两个你可能较为熟悉的是 %id(空闲 百分比) 和 %wa(I/O 等待 百分比)。如果 %id 很低, 那么说明CPU的工作负载很大并且没有多少计算负载能力剩余。...如果 %wa 很高,则说明瓶 CPU 处于等待计算的状态,但是正在等待I/O活动的完成(类似 从数据库中获取存储在 磁盘上 的一行数据)。...%wa 很高,则说明瓶 CPU 处于等待计算的状态,但是正在等待I/O活动的完成(类似 从数据库中获取存储在 磁盘上 的一行数据)。

    13710

    CSS Layout API初探:瀑布流布局实现

    - edges.inline;接下来,我们来获取瀑布流列数(因为值是整数且默认值为4,我们无需做任何处理,读进来就好)//获取定义的瀑布流列数const column = styleMap.get('...不过好在所有相对单位和绝对单位在传入时都会自动转换成px,所以实际上我们只需要处理百分比和calc函数,css里边的calc函数是支持嵌套的,所以我们这里使用递归来完成计算,同时将百分比转换为像素值。...let gap = styleMap.get('--masonry-gap');// 将计算属性和百分比处理成像素值gap = calc(gap, availableInlineSize);我们需要根据列数和间隔计算出子元素的宽度...我们需要记录每一列的当前高度,在布局新元素时,选取其中最短的一列进行插入操作(倘若按照顺序插入会导致每列的高度差距过大)// 设定子元素宽度,获取fragmentslet childFragments...] + gap);}与普通瀑布流唯一的不同可能是在最后一步,我们需要更新容器的高度,所以每布局一个子元素,都尝试记录目前最高那列的高度。

    90030

    任意半径中值滤波(扩展至百分比滤波器)O(1)时间复杂度算法的原理、实现及效果。

    我们这里提出的算法也是用直方图的计算来取代如龟速的排序。最近,Weiss使用层次直方图技术获取了O(log r)复杂度的效果,在他的方法中,虽然速度是快了,但是代码复杂难懂。...每列直方图累积了2r+1个垂直方向上相邻像素的信息,初始的时候,这2r+1个像素是分别以第一行的每个像素为中心的。核的直方图通过累积2r+1个相邻的列直方图数据获取。...对于当前行,核最右侧的列直方图首先需要更新,而此时该列的列直方图中的数据还是以上一行对应位置那个像素为中心计算的。因此需要减去最上一个像素对应的直方图然后加上其下面一像素的直方图信息。...综上所述,所有的单像素操作(包括更新列以及核直方图、计算中值)都是 O(1)操作。现在,我们重点来说说初始化操作,即通过累积前r行的数据来计算列直方图以及从前r列直方图数据计算第一个像素点的核直方图。...同上述交替更新列和核直方图不同的是,我们可以首先更新整行的列直方图。然后利用SIMD指令,我们可以并行的更新多列直方图数据(不同列直方图的更新之间没有任何关系,所以好并行)。

    1.7K20

    使用 Python 进行财务数据分析实战

    首先选择了调整后的收盘价列,然后计算了每日的百分比变化,对任何缺失值用 0 进行了替换。接下来,将百分比变化数据框打印到控制台。...首先,对数据进行重新采样,以获取每个月的最后一个工作日,并使用lambda函数选择每个月的最后一个数据点,创建了名为monthly的新时间序列。...此外,还提供了该函数的示例用法,其中获取了四家科技公司的数据,并显示了组合数据集的前几行。...然后,我们重置指数数据,以便每行代表一个日期,每列代表一个股票代码。 接着,我们使用 pct_change() 方法计算股票价格的每日百分比变化,并将其呈现在一个有 50 个箱的直方图中。...该代码还计算头寸差异,更新“持股”和“现金”列,计算投资组合在一段时间内的总回报。本质上,该代码根据给定的信号模拟“AAPL”的股票交易。

    94910

    数据人必会的Excel|连Excel透视表都不会,别说你会数据分析!

    Excel中的数据透视表可谓是数据分析师们的得力助手,学会Excel的数据透视表能够让数据分析师们高效地进行数据统计汇总、字段计算、更新数据源等操作。...今天,我们会以Kaggle平台上经典的Titanic数据集是为例,讲解数据透视表的用法并对该数据集做一个简单的数据统计分析。...字段列表:也就是我们在插入透视表之前所选中的数据内容所包含的字段,可以通过勾选把不同的字段放到筛选框、行、列、值当中。 筛选:需要进行分组的字段,也相当于所谓的filter 列:列值。 行:行值。...这字段列表左下角有一个延迟布局更新的功能,当数据量较大时,就可以选定这个延迟更新,该功能相当于需要等我们的字段设置完成之后才进行数据更新,可以最大程度保证我们操作的流畅。 ?...透视表除了可以选择【行汇总的百分比】之外,还有多种形式可以选择,例如,【差异】、【差异百分比】等等,可以根据自己的需要选择相应的计算方式。

    1.5K10

    iOS开发之CoreMotion框架的应用 原

    ,这个框架对加速度,磁力以及螺旋仪传感器信息进行统一管理,并封装了许多强大的计算方法帮助开发者获取设备的空间状态。      ...主要包括开启更新信息,停止更新信息,获取更新信息等。...)handler; //停止更新设备运动信息 - (void)stopDeviceMotionUpdates; 上面的方法看上去非常繁多,其实很有规律,总的来说就是对是否开启传感器数据进行管理,并且进行传感器数据的获取...设备持有者是否在骑自行车 @property(readonly, nonatomic) BOOL cycling; @end 六、用户手臂动作分析       在iOS 12系统后,CoreMotion框架中又引入了一些列配合...float percentNone; //可能发生震颤的百分比低 微震颤 @property (nonatomic, readonly) float percentSlight; //可能发生震颤的百分比高

    1.6K20

    Soulver for Mac(Mac计算器软件)

    右边的是答案您的答案会在您输入时立即计算出来。当问题的任何部分发生变化时,答案会自动更新。它非常适合快速计算。单词和数字在一起Soulver独特地允许您在数字旁边使用单词,因此您的计算是有意义的。...容易百分比Soulver很容易弄清楚百分比的问题。您只需按预期输入问题即可。Soulver支持许多不同的百分比表达式。转换和单位您只需输入您期望的内容即可进行转换。...当该行更改时,您的行将自动更新。您可以使用答案令牌进行可重复使用的计算,有点像电子表格。便利的统计数据您可以在Soulver窗口的右下方看到所有行。...您可以在答案列或文本编辑器中选择一些行,并仅查看选择的总计。您还可以选择平均值,标准差和方差。功能丰富Soulver具有内置的所有标准数学函数,因此无需返回旧的科学计算器。...您可以使用十六进制和二进制进行计算,并使用格式栏选择答案的基础。您还可以使用答案选项板查看任何行的二进制和十六进制转换。格式化栏Soulver的格式化栏非常适合快速更改答案格式的方式。

    91010

    Sentry 监控 - Discover 大数据查询分析引擎

    * 导出 CSV * 删除查询 * 添加查询方程式 * 添加方程式 * 方程式指南 * 示例方程式 * 计算完成事务的百分比...要重命名已保存的查询,请单击标题旁边的铅笔图标并输入所需的显示名称。单击“enter”或点击区域外以保存更新的名称。 分享查询 随时分享您的疑问。您可以与也有权访问同一组织的其他用户共享 URL。...随着查询的每个部分的构建,结果会更新,URL 也会更新,以便可以在电子邮件、聊天等中共享正在进行的搜索。 导出 CSV 如果您想将数据带到别处,请单击 “Export” 以获取 CSV 文件。...: 这些等式可以帮助您计算以下内容: 在阈值内完成的 transaction 百分比 https://docs.sentry.io/product/discover-queries/query-builder...获取在阈值内完成的事务百分比 使用以下三列创建一个新查询: * 列 1: * Function count_if * Field transaction.duration

    3.5K10

    SQL Server优化50法

    3、没有创建计算列导致查询不优化。...如果另外安装了全文检索功能,并打算运行 Microsoft 搜索服务以便执行全文索引和查询,可考虑:将虚拟内存大小配置为至少是计算机中安装的物理内存的 3 倍。...更新锁将阻止任何其它任务获取更新锁或排它锁,从而阻止其它任务更新该行。然而,更新锁并不阻止共享锁,所以它不会阻止其它任务读取行,除非第二个任务也在要求带更新锁的读取。...滚动锁在提取时在每行上获取,并保持到下次提取或者游标关闭,以先发生者为准。下次提取时,服务器为新提取中的行获取滚动锁,并释放上次提取中行的滚动锁。...由于 DPC 是以特权模式执行的,DPC 时间的百分比为特权时间百分比的一部分。这些时间单独计算并且不属于间隔计算总数的一部分。这个总数显示了作为实例时间百分比的平均忙时。

    2.1K70

    Java HashMap 简介与工作原理

    散列映射表对键进行散列,数映射表的整体顺序对元素进行排序,并将其组织成搜索树。 散列或比较函数只能左右与键。与键关联的值不能进行散列或比较。 每当往映射表中添加或检索对象时,必须同时提供一个键。...extends V> map) 用给定的容量和装填因子构造一个空散列映射表。 装填因子是一个0.0~1.0之间的数值。这数值决定散列表填充的百分比。默认装填因子是0.75。...一旦到了这个百分比,就要将其再散列(rehashed)到更大的表中,并将现有元素插入新表,并舍弃原来的表。...检查table实例是否存在,获取table的长度 检查输入的hash值,计算得到索引值 若table中对应索引值中没有元素,插入新建的元素 检查当前是否需要扩充容量 尝试更新现有的元素 若使用了二叉树结构...默认容量n=16,计算得到索引是7。以此类推。 get 方法流程 计算输入key对象的hash值,根据hash值查找。 若map中不存在相应的key,则返回null。

    1.8K100

    PowerBI 2018年11月更新 支持PowerBI工程式开发

    重提获取更新的方式 很多伙伴询问如果保持PowerBI最新,请使用Windows10系统,并在 Windows Store商店中搜索并免费安装PowerBI Desktop,它将自动保持最新,当更新可用时...并粘贴到另一个 PBIX 文件中。其原理如下: 将视觉对象从A文件复制粘贴至B文件,如果B文件具有同样名称的列和度量值则使用,否则则报错,并提供修复错失: ?...由于数值和百分比都是数字类型,因此在设置格式的时候,如果选择了数字类型,那百分比将变成小数显示,这是用户无法接受的。...满足非侵入式设计的表现是: 度量值优先 度量值代替计算列 虚拟关系 观察以下模型: ? 模型本身仅仅表达业务关系本身,没有与业务逻辑无关的表混入模型。...度量值由全局表统一管理;尽量避免计算列,度量值优先;在需要使用计算列的时候,可以在PQ阶段完成;在需要辅助表完成报表计算的时候使用虚拟关系(TREATAS)。

    4.1K20

    数据仓库系列之数据质量管理

    第一、 缺省值分析   产生原因:   1、有些信息暂时无法获取,或者获取信息的代价太大   2、有些信息是被遗漏的,人为或者信息采集机器故障   3、属性值不存在,比如一个未婚者配偶的姓名、一个儿童的固定收入...初步评估报告的目的是获得对数据和环境的了解,并对数据的状况进行描述。...用时一致性 合理性检查,将经过的时间与过去填充相同字段的数据的实例作比较 11 一致性 数值类型检查 数额字段跨二级字段计算结果的一致性 合理性检查,将跨一个或多个二级字段的数额列的计算结果、数量总和...、占总数的百分比和平均数量与历史计数和百分比作比较,用限定符缩小比较结果 12 完整性/有效性 数据行数 有效性检查,表内多列,详细结果 将同一个表中相关列的值与映射关系或业务规则中的值作比较 13 完整性...37 完整性/一致性 跨表的数值类型检查 跨表数额列计算结果的一致性 跨表合理性检查,比较相关表的汇总数额字段总计,占总计百分比、平均值或它们之间的比率 38 完整性/一致性 跨表的汇总数据日期检查

    3.1K37
    领券